Strategic Analysis with Financial Competitive Profile Matrix

Omodiaogbe Samuel

By the end of this guided project, you will be able to use the Financial Competitive Profile Matrix (FCPM) to analyze your industry and identify your competitive advantage with key financial indicators. FCPM is a strategic management tool that enables you to benchmark your company in relation to competition and then identify the relative strengths and weaknesses of all the competitors based on some Financial Critical Success Factors (FCSFs) analysis. The FCSFs are assigned weight based on their importance, ranked on their strengths and weaknesses, then the weight is multiplied by the rank to determine weighted score. The sum of the weighted score reveals the company that has competitive advantage or disadvantage in the industry.
